Start your morning by heading to Kailasagiri Hill Park, a beautiful hilltop park offering panoramic views of the city and the Bay of Bengal. Enjoy the serene atmosphere and take a ride on the ropeway for a thrilling experience. In the afternoon, visit the Submarine Museum, a unique attraction where you can explore a real decommissioned submarine. Learn about India's naval history and discover life on a submarine. End your day with a stroll along the popular Ramakrishna Beach.
Embark on a day trip to the magnificent Borra Caves, located around 90 kilometers from Vishakapatnam. Marvel at the stunning stalactite and stalagmite formations inside the caves, which are millions of years old. In the afternoon, visit the Simhachalam Temple, dedicated to Lord Narasimha. Explore the intricately carved temple and admire the beautiful architecture. Return to Vishakapatnam in the evening.
Head to Rushikonda Beach in the morning and spend a relaxing day by the sandy shores. Enjoy water sports activities like jet skiing, banana boat rides, and parasailing. In the afternoon, take a leisurely stroll along RK Beach Road, a popular promenade lined with shops, cafes, and street food stalls. Don't miss trying some delicious local snacks. Capture the beautiful sunset views at RK Beach.
Embark on a scenic journey to the picturesque Araku Valley, situated amidst the Eastern Ghats. Enjoy the breathtaking views of lush green valleys and waterfalls along the way. Visit the Coffee Museum to learn about the famous Araku coffee and its production process. Explore the tribal culture and handicrafts at the Tribal Museum. Indulge in local cuisine at a tribal village. Return to Vishakapatnam in the evening.
In the morning, visit Dolphin's Nose, a unique rocky promontory that offers breathtaking views of the coastline. Take in the beauty of the surrounding hills and the vast ocean. In the afternoon, head to Yarada Beach, known for its tranquil atmosphere and golden sands. Enjoy swimming in the clear waters or simply relax on the beach. Witness a mesmerizing sunset before returning to Vishakapatnam.
Spend your last day in Vishakapatnam exploring the Indira Gandhi Zoological Park, home to a wide variety of animals and birds. Take a safari ride to see animals in their natural habitat. In the afternoon, indulge in some shopping at the local markets. From handicrafts to clothing and souvenirs, Vishakapatnam offers a range of options. End your trip with a delicious seafood dinner at a beachfront restaurant.
For off-the-beaten-path attractions, consider visiting the Kambalakonda Wildlife Sanctuary, located close to Vishakapatnam. This sanctuary offers nature trails, bird watching, and an opportunity to spot wildlife in their natural habitat. Families will also enjoy a visit to the Ramanaidu Film Studio, where you can take a guided tour and learn about the fascinating world of Indian cinema. These attractions provide unique experiences and are family-friendly.
